Double Spring is a census-designated place (CDP) in Douglas County, Nevada, United States. The population was 158 at the 2010 census.[2]
Geography
Double Spring is located 16 miles (26 km) southeast of Minden on the west side of U.S. Route 395. According to the United States Census Bureau, the CDP has a total area of 8.8 square miles (22.7 km2), all of it land.[2]
